The Meade County inmate population is centered on one local detention facility, the Meade County Sheriff's Office jail in the City of Meade. Research found no city jail, state prison, Federal Bureau of Prisons facility, or ICE detention center physically located in Meade County. That makes the local map simple, but the lookup process is still split by custody type. People booked on local arrests, short county sentences, warrants, or pending transport may be in the county jail. People sentenced to Kansas prison move to the KDOC KASPER system. Federal and immigration custody use separate national locators.

Meade County does not publish a live jail population dashboard, a daily population report, or a county-hosted roster with every current inmate. The public path starts with the county's official inmate search page, which points to Kansas VINE for custody status and notification registration. When VINE does not answer the question, the jail information line, sheriff records staff, Kansas open-records requests, the district court clerk, and state or federal locators become the next channels.

Who Counts in Meade County Custody

The Meade County inmate population may include several groups at once. A person can be held before trial after arrest, after a judge sets bond, while serving a county sentence, on a warrant, or while waiting for transfer to another custody system. The detention officer job description says jail staff process inmates in and out of custody, prepare jail and inmate reports and accounts, issue meals and medication, monitor sickness or injury, and supervise court, medical, dental, and other-facility transports.

Clark County is the most important local exception. The Clark County Jail page states that all persons arrested and taken into custody are transported to Meade County Jail for booking and incarceration, and that the jail houses both pretrial and post-conviction inmates. That means a person arrested outside Meade County may still be in the Meade County inmate population. Searchers should not stop at county lines when the arrest happened in Ashland, Minneola, Englewood, or elsewhere in Clark County.

  • Pretrial detainees are held while charges, bond, and hearings are pending.
  • County-sentenced inmates may serve shorter local sentences at the jail.
  • Transport cases may wait in Meade before transfer to KDOC or another authority.
  • Clark County inmates may appear in Meade custody because Clark County uses the Meade County Jail.

Meade County Jail Capacity

The best current capacity value located for the Meade County Jail is 56 beds, but the county website does not display a current rated-capacity page, housing-unit list, or daily occupancy count. Older historic data showed 24 beds in 2006, so a reader should treat capacity as a current-contact issue when exact space, crowding, or classification matters. The jail itself is the right source for current custody status and operational limits.

Kansas statutes define who has custody authority over the jail. K.S.A. 19-811 places charge and custody of the county jail and prisoners with the sheriff. K.S.A. 19-1930 requires the sheriff or jailer to receive and safely keep prisoners committed by county, federal, city, or KDOC authority until released by law. K.S.A. 19-1935 requires a Kansas Bureau of Investigation inquiry when a city or county prisoner dies in jail or a contracted facility.

Kansas custody law: Jail population data and booking facts sit inside a public-records framework, but the sheriff remains the local custodian for jail confinement and release questions.


Meade County Inmate Records Access

Kansas open-records law matters because Meade County does not publish a full roster online. K.S.A. 45-221 allows certain records to be withheld, including criminal-investigation records, when an exemption applies. The Kansas Attorney General's KORA FAQ explains that law-enforcement agencies may refuse some investigative records. Research also notes that Kansas definitions exclude jail rosters from criminal-investigation records, so a jail roster is treated differently from an investigative file.

The practical result is a layered access path. Custody status starts with VINE and the jail. Formal booking material may require a request to sheriff records or the county's open-records request form. Formal charges belong in the district court record after the county attorney files the case. A complete criminal history is separate again, through the Kansas.gov criminal history search, which research found is fee-based and available during posted daily hours.

Meade County Jail vs Prison Lookup

Lookup mistakes often come from searching the wrong custody system. Meade County Jail is for local custody. KDOC KASPER is for Kansas state supervision and prison custody. The BOP locator covers federal inmates from 1982 forward, and ICE ODLS covers current ICE custody and some recent CBP custody. One person can move across these systems as the case changes.

Custody TypeWhere to LookWhat It Covers
County jailMeade County inmate search, Kansas VINE, jail phoneLocal pretrial, county-sentenced, warrant, Clark County, and transport cases
Kansas state prisonKDOC KASPERSentenced or supervised people in KDOC-funded or KDOC-operated status
Federal custodyBOP Inmate LocatorFederal inmates from 1982 to present
Immigration custodyICE Online Detainee LocatorCurrent ICE detainees and some recent CBP custody cases

Note: A local bond may not lead to release when another agency has lodged a detainer, warrant, parole hold, federal hold, or immigration hold.

Meade County Inmate Population FAQ

How big is the Meade County inmate population? A live daily count was not published in the official sources reviewed. The best located capacity value is 56 beds, while older historic facility data listed 24 beds. For a current count, call the jail information line.

How do I search the Meade County inmate population? Start with the county inmate-search page, then use Kansas VINE for custody status and notification registration. If the result is missing or time-sensitive, call the jail or sheriff office.

Can a Clark County arrestee be in Meade County Jail? Yes. Clark County's official jail page states that people arrested there are transported to Meade County Jail for booking and incarceration.

Where are court charges found after arrest? Filed charges are court records. Use Kansas CaseSearch or contact the Meade County District Court after the county attorney files a complaint or information.
